Mechanical engineering is the backbone of the German economy and is also strongly represented in Austria and Switzerland. Which metrics are typical, which are critical? A benchmark guide for the mechanical engineering industry.
Note: The market data in this article is based on information from VDMA and national statistical offices. The benchmark values are reference values for orientation and vary by company size and segment.
Market Overview
Mechanical Engineering in Numbers (VDMA, Destatis 2024)
| Region |
Revenue |
Companies |
Employees |
| Germany |
~265 billion EUR |
~6,700 |
~1.1 million |
| Austria |
~25 billion EUR |
~1,200 |
~80,000 |
| Switzerland |
~30 billion CHF |
~900 |
~75,000 |

Benchmark Metrics
| Company Size |
Weak |
Average |
Good |
| Small (<50M EUR) |
<20% |
25-35% |
>40% |
| Medium (50-250M EUR) |
<25% |
30-40% |
>45% |
| Large (>250M EUR) |
<30% |
35-45% |
>50% |
Industry characteristic: Mechanical engineering is capital-intensive (machinery, inventories), but traditionally solidly financed.

Mechanical Engineering-Specific Metrics
Order Intake / Book-to-Bill
| Value |
Meaning |
| <0.9 |
Contraction, demand declining |
| 0.9-1.0 |
Stagnation |
| 1.0-1.1 |
Healthy growth |
| >1.1 |
Strong growth (check capacity) |
Order Backlog (in months)
| Months |
Assessment |
| <3 |
Critical, underutilization imminent |
| 3-6 |
Tight |
| 6-9 |
Healthy |
| 9-12 |
Very good |
| >12 |
Excellent (but watch delivery times) |
Export Ratio
| Ratio |
Typical for |
| <20% |
Regional, niche |
| 20-50% |
Nationally oriented |
| 50-70% |
Export-oriented |
| >70% |
Global player |
DACH Average: ~65% (Germany), ~50% (Austria), ~75% (Switzerland)

Working Capital in Mechanical Engineering
Typical Metrics
| Metric |
Typical |
Note |
| DSO (Receivables) |
50-70 days |
Often longer after acceptance |
| DIO (Inventory) |
90-150 days |
Long production times |
| DPO (Payables) |
40-60 days |
Standard |
| Cash Conversion Cycle |
100-150 days |
Capital-intensive |
Specialty: Advance Payments
Common in mechanical engineering:
- 30% advance payment at order
- 30% at delivery
- 30% at acceptance
- 10% retention
Balance Sheet Impact:
- Advance payments received as liability
- Reduce tied-up capital
- Important for liquidity
Risk Factors
Cyclicality
Mechanical engineering is highly cyclical:
- Early indicator for economic downturn
- Order intake reacts quickly
- Revenue follows with delay (order backlog)
Historical Fluctuations:
- 2009: Revenue -23%
- 2020: Revenue -12%
- 2022: Revenue +9%

Red Flags in Mechanical Engineering
| Signal |
Interpretation |
| Order intake <0.8 |
Demand collapsing |
| Order backlog <3 months |
Short-term underutilization |
| Material ratio rising sharply |
Price pressure or inefficiency |
| Service revenue declining |
Installed base shrinking |
| R&D ratio below 2% |
Innovation stop |
Yellow Flags
| Signal |
Monitor |
| Export ratio rising too fast |
Currency risk, dependency |
| Single order >30% revenue |
Concentration risk |
| Book-to-bill persistently >1.2 |
Possible delivery problems |

Valuation of Mechanical Engineering Companies
Multiples
| Type |
EV/EBITDA |
EV/Revenue |
| Standard/Commodity |
5-7x |
0.5-0.8x |
| Specialized |
7-9x |
0.8-1.2x |
| Premium/Niche |
9-12x |
1.0-1.5x |
| Market leader/Global |
10-14x |
1.2-2.0x |

Regional Characteristics
Germany
- Largest mechanical engineering location in Europe
- VDMA as strong association
- Hidden champions
- Strong concentration in Baden-Wuerttemberg, Bavaria, NRW
Austria
- Strong in special machine manufacturing
- Supplier to German industry
- Smaller, specialized players
Switzerland
- Highest value added per employee
- Premium segment
- Strong in precision and quality
- Watch/medtech-related machines
Conclusion
Mechanical engineering is a cyclical but fundamentally solid industry with a strong position in the DACH region. The metrics differ greatly by segment - special machine manufacturers have different benchmarks than series manufacturers.
For analysis, important points:
1. Classify segment correctly
2. Consider cycle position
3. Use order intake as leading indicator
4. Evaluate service share as stability factor
5. Check dependencies (automotive, export)
